A malignant kidney tumor, caused by the uncontrolled multiplication of renal stem (blastemal), stromal ( STROMAL CELLS), and epithelial ( EPITHELIAL CELLS) elements. However, not all three are present in every case. Several genes or chromosomal areas have been associated with Wilms tumor which is usually found in childhood as a firm lump in a child's side or ABDOMEN.
